My initial spark of writing passion was about shining a bright light on the shadowy world of ICBC and other personal injury claims.

It didnsa国际传媒檛 take long for road safety topics to work their way in.

I have the unique opportunity to investigate the causes of crashes and collisions that result in lifetimes of consequences.

Car crash causes are commonly labeled for the traffic rule that was broken, i.e. failing to yield, failing to stop for a stop sign, etc. But when you really dig into it, you realize that the root cause is inattention.

Drivers donsa国际传媒檛 purposefully pull out from stop signs in the paths of other vehicles. The fact is that they donsa国际传媒檛 see the oncoming vehicle thatsa国际传媒檚 there to be seen because of sa国际传媒渋nattention blindnesssa国际传媒.

The more I put my mind to it, the clearer I saw the problem and could identify solutions. And the more I became convinced that I could help steer road safety policies in the right direction.

This column was my pulpit.
